ÖAMTC Warns of Severe Pentecost Traffic and Border Queues Across Austria

Austria’s motoring club projects record congestion over the 22–25 May Pentecost break, with major jams on the Brenner, Tauern and Pyhrn routes and construction-related lane closures near Vienna and Linz. Exit bans on secondary roads and selective truck restrictions will further complicate logistics, prompting companies to pad travel schedules and monitor live traffic feeds.

Austria Imposes 5-Day Heavy-Truck Ban on A10 Tauern Corridor

A ministerial decree bans lorries over 7.5 t from the northbound A10 Tauern Autobahn for five days starting 18 May 2026. Freight operators must divert or reschedule, adding costs and transit time for cross-Alpine supply chains.

EU Launches ‘Visa Cascade’—Longer-Validity Schengen Visas for Thai Travellers, Applying EU-Wide Including Austria

A new EU “Visa Cascade” allows Thai travellers to obtain 1-, 2- or 5-year multi-entry Schengen visas based on previous compliant travel, reducing repeat applications at the Austrian Embassy in Bangkok. The scheme benefits Austrian employers who rely on frequent Thai visitors for projects and training.
